Recognized by Newsweek in 2024 and 2025 as one of America's Greatest Workplaces for Diversity About the Director of Nursing Position As Director of Nursing at Brookdale, you will utilize your leadership qualities to inspire, lead and manage the overall operation of the clinical team to provide the highest quality of care and services for our residents.
You will proactively build relationships with residents, families, physicians and other healthcare providers for the coordination of exceptional personalized care.
You will consistently collaborate with community leadership, mentor and engage your associates and build resident and family satisfaction. Brookdale supports our Nurse Leaders through: * Structured six-week orientation, a wealth of online resources, local nurse mentors and ongoing collaborative support. * Tuition reimbursement to support your clinical expertise and leadership skills development. * Network of almost 700 communities in 40 states to support you should relocation be in your future. This is a great opportunity for a strong nurse leader looking to take the next step in their professional career or for an experienced Director of Nursing looking to join a reputable mission and purpose-driven organization where you can make a contribution. Qualifications & Skills * Education as required to obtain state nursing license and state nursing license (LPN/LVN or RN) * Driver's license * Minimum of 3 years relevant experience, and Clinical leadership experience preferred. * Strong working knowledge of technology, proficiency in Microsoft office suite and electronic documentation. The application window is anticipated to close within 30 days of the date of the posting.Manages the day-to-day clinical services of a highly complex, multiple product line, or large community.
Ensures residents' healthcare needs are met while treated with respect and dignity, and ensures quality care as residents' healthcare needs change.
Supervises and provides leadership, as well as coaching, to licensed nurses and other direct care staff within the community.
May be responsible for leading additional clinical leadership team of five or more members.
The HWD level for each community is determined based on the total complexity of the role.
Complexity criteria include, but are not limited to, factors such as size, type of product lines, medication management regulations, 90-day assessment requirements, multiple licensure requirements, state regulatory complexity, and skilled services requiring an RN.
